The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ration tightens the leash on carriers that have been sanctioned. 49 CFR Part 386 has been amended, and the new rule will go into effect May 29, 2012.According to truckinginfo.com,The key change: paying a full civil penalty in an enforcement proceeding does not give the entity the ability to unilaterally avoid an admission of liability.
